Transaction 1270e788892e6276bcc3e98cffcc5092bcea0088357b0e0b34a4490ea5cd4ded

94 Input
1 Outputs
  • 1270e788892e6276bcc3e98cffcc5092bcea0088357b0e0b34a4490ea5cd4ded:0
  • value  538643771
    address  bc1q4c8n5t00jmj8temxdgcc3t32nkg2wjwz24lywv